Well fellow Lactnetters:

What an uplifting sight to see front page photo in the Sacramento Bee Newspaper
of the Policy Chief for the California Assembly Speaker cuddling her baby with
attached headline :"Nursing mothers get room of their own at the Capitol."
Deborah Gonzalez, policy chief convinced her boss Assembly Speaker Curt Pringle
(R) to  designate a room for moms to pump or feed babies. The article goes on to
state that the public can use this nursing room as well! The article  quoted in
big bold type one of our wonderful area LC's, Jeanett Burruel, on cost benefits
of BF friendly workplace .   I encourage all my fellow Californian lactnetters
